Saya pikir begitu

I think so

Bedeutung

Expressing a tentative or moderate agreement

🌍

Kultureller Hintergrund

Indonesians often use 'Saya pikir begitu' to avoid saying 'No' directly. If someone asks for a favor and you say 'I think so' but don't follow up, it might be a 'polite no'. In Javanese culture, the concept of 'Alus' (refinement) means you should never be too assertive. 'Saya pikir begitu' is a very 'alus' way to speak. In Jakarta, people are more direct but still use 'Kayaknya' (the informal version) constantly to sound 'cool' and relaxed. In meetings, this phrase is used to show you are a team player. Agreeing with the boss using 'Saya pikir begitu' shows alignment without being a 'yes-man'.

💡

The 'Sih' Factor

Add 'sih' at the end ('Saya pikir begitu, sih') to sound even more like a native speaker. It adds a touch of 'well...' or 'I guess...'

⚠️

Don't be too 'Saya'

If you are with friends, using 'Saya' too much makes you sound like a robot or a politician. Switch to 'Aku'!

🎯

The Head Nod

When saying this, a slight, slow nod of the head makes the agreement feel much more sincere in Indonesian culture.

💬

Saving Face

Use this phrase if you think someone is wrong but don't want to embarrass them. It's a gentle way to start a correction.
